Fairfax board adopts new Reston vision, possibly doubling development
By Michael Neibauer
Washington Business Journal
Feb. 11, 2014
"The new vision for Reston that the Fairfax County Board of Supervisors approved Tuesday is very much like the original vision for Reston, just larger.
The board voted 6-2 to adopt the revised Reston Master Plan, an amendment to the 6,700-acre Reston blueprint created by Bob Simon more than 50 years ago. Crafted by a 25-member task force of community leaders and property owners over the last four-plus years, the plan has the potential to more than double the amount of development in Reston over the next 25-30 years.
It allows for the construction of 22,000 new residential units, nearly 9 million square feet of new office space, 2.2 million square feet of new hotel space and 700,000 square feet of additional retail, while reducing industrial space by about 300,000 square feet..."
